Can you wear boots with a romper?

Ankle boots with rompers: For a casual romper, such as a chambray or solid color, go with a pair of ankle booties to create a long and streamlined look. A long sleeved rompers will look best with tall boots which will balance out the coverage you have on top, with your tall boots on the bottom.

What does a playsuit look like?

The main style of playsuit was a one-piece romper. The top resembled a button-down blouse that would come in at the waist and extend into shorts. A waistband often defined the waist and separated top from bottom. Some shorts were pleated all the way around so they looked like tennis skirts.

What do you wear under a short romper?

Pair a prim romper with leggings or tights for a more conservative look. This will also help combat against the office AC that's always on the fritz (you know what we're talking about). For added effect, opt for a collared shirt underneath the romper.

Can you wear a playsuit to work?

Instead, choose playsuits with high necks and full sleeves, or three quarter length legs in a wide cut. And don't worry – if you've absolutely fallen in love with a spaghetti-strapped playsuit, you can still make it work-appropriate by wearing a t-shirt underneath.
